Why These Are the Top Hyundai Repair Auto Repair Shops in Bala Cynwyd

** The Hyundai repair market in the Bala Cynwyd area is characterized by a clear dichotomy. On one side, there are high-quality, long-standing independent shops like Hong's Auto that offer expert mechanical repair for complex issues, often at a more competitive labor rate than the dealership. Their strength lies in deep mechanical work (engines, transmissions, turbos) for vehicles outside of warranty. On the other side, the authorized dealership (Keystone Hyundai) is the unavoidable specialist for all factory-mandated procedures, especially concerning warranty extensions, safety system recalibrations, and high-voltage systems. The "competition" is therefore not direct; a savvy owner may use the dealership for warranty and HV work and an independent specialist for everything else. Pricing reflects this specialization. Dealership labor rates are typically the highest ($150-$180/hr), while top-tier independents are moderately priced ($120-$150/hr). The market is not saturated with true Hyundai *specialists*; many general repair shops lack the specific training and tools for DCTs, GDI carbon cleaning, and Hyundai-specific electronics, making the identified providers stand out significantly.

What are the most common Hyundai repair issues for drivers in Bala Cynwyd?

In Bala Cynwyd, common issues include electrical problems with power windows/locks, engine sensor failures (like the crankshaft position sensor), and suspension wear from our local potholes and rough roads. Some Hyundai models may also experience steering column noises, which a local specialist can quickly diagnose.

How can I find a trustworthy, independent Hyundai repair shop in Bala Cynwyd versus using the dealership?

Look for shops on Montgomery Avenue or in the Bryn Mawr area that are ASE-certified and specifically advertise Hyundai or Korean auto expertise. Check for online reviews mentioning long-term customer relationships and ask if they use O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) or high-quality aftermarket parts to ensure reliability.

Are repair costs for Hyundais generally higher at Bala Cynwyd dealerships compared to local mechanics?

Yes, dealership labor rates are typically higher, but they offer factory-trained technicians and genuine Hyundai parts. For out-of-warranty vehicles, a reputable independent shop in Bala Cynwyd can provide significant savings, often 20-30%, while still performing quality repairs, especially for routine maintenance and common fixes.

When should I seek immediate Hyundai service given the local climate and driving conditions?

Seek immediate service for any warning lights (especially the check engine or oil pressure light), unusual brake noises given our hilly terrain, or if you notice steering pull, which could indicate alignment damage from potholes. Also, address heating system issues before winter to avoid being stranded in cold weather.

What local considerations should I keep in mind for Hyundai maintenance in Bala Cynwyd?

The stop-and-go traffic on City Avenue and Route 23 can accelerate brake and transmission wear, so adhere strictly to fluid change intervals. Given Pennsylvania's seasonal road treatments, frequent undercarriage washes are crucial to prevent rust, and tire rotations are key due to the curved, often congested local roads.
